RIYADH — The Saudi Ministry of Interior emphasized that expatriates, who overstay their visas, will face a maximum jail term of six months, a fine of SR50,000, in addition to their deportation.The ministry urged all individuals to comply with the regulations governing the 2026 Hajj season and to cooperate with the relevant authorities to ensure the safety and security of pilgrims. Violators will be subject to legal penalties.The ministry also called for reporting violations by dialing 911 in the regions of Makkah, Madinah, Riyadh, and the Eastern Province, and 999 in the rest of the Kingdom. JEDDAH — Leaders of the Gulf Cooperation Council (GCC) underscored the importance of enhancing military integration, including the rapid deployment of a unified early warning system against ballistic missile threats during their consultative summit held in Jeddah on Tuesday. They strongly condemned Iranian attacks targeting member states and rejected any attempt to close the Strait of Hormuz. The summit, chaired by Saudi Crown Prince and Prime Minister Mohammed bin Salman, was convened following an invitation by Custodian of the Two Holy Mosques King Salman, according to GCC Secretary General Jassim Mohammed Albudaiwi. WASHINGTON, 27th April, 2026 (WAM) — Microsoft (MSFT) on Monday announced an amended long-term agreement with OpenAI (OPAI.PVT) that will see the company no longer have exclusive access to the AI startup’s intellectual property and AI models, while also altering its revenue-sharing deal with OpenAI. The news comes ahead of Microsoft’s earnings report on Wednesday, and just six months after the two companies formalised an agreement that allowed OpenAI to transform into a for-profit business. Meta Platforms recently entered into a partnership to the use solar energy collected in space to power its AI data centres. This announcement aligns with the company’s plans to develop new solutions to support rising demands for the technology. Meta stated it has struck a deal with Overview Energy for up to 1 gigawatt of space solar energy to support data centre operations, making it one of the first technology companies to secure capacity reservation. The UAE’s decision on Tuesday to exit Opec and Opec+ is likely to have a beneficial impact on its ties with India, bringing the two countries closer, especially on the oil and gas front, analysts said. Narendra Taneja, chairman, Independent Energy Policy Institute, told NDTV Profit on Tuesday evening that the UAE is looking for more autonomy and focus on supplying oil to countries like India, which is closer to it in bilateral ties. “The UAE and India have deep relations and this will only improve now,” he said. MAKKAH — Hajj Security Forces arrested a Pakistani resident for violating Hajj regulations by transporting five residents of the same nationality and attempting to enter Makkah and remain there without a Hajj permit. They were referred to the Public Prosecution after taking the necessary legal measures. The General Directorate of Public Security urged all people to comply with Hajj regulations and guidelines for the 2026 Hajj season and to cooperate with relevant authorities to ensure the security and safety of pilgrims.
